Q: My husband does not pay zakah on his savings even after reminders that it is a fardh and the punishment of not fulfilling this fardh. My question is that he gives me momey for the maintenance of the house and for my needs and that of our children, is it sinful for me to use his money? I do fear that him not paying his zakah may bring a calamity (Allah Ta’ala forbid) on our family.

Bismillaah

A: No.
